    Overall I find the IH community to be an amazing place where I can find support and inspiration from other people in the same boat as me. But having said that, I guess it depends on your definition of spam, but I've noticed more recently too.

    The two types of spam I see are:

    1. people name-dropping their product at every single opportunity. This forum shouldn't be seen as a direct customer acquisition channel and if you view it as that then you have a clear conflict of interest, in which case yes, I see your posts as spammy.

    2. people posting miracle success stories to drum up interest about their app (or seed backlinks or whatever silly tactic they are trying). I'm talking about people with sparse posting history who come in here to post milestones that their app noone has ever heard of is making millions of dollars.
